Emma graduated as a Dental Therapist from Cardiff University in 2019. This means she can
perform dental hygiene as well as restorative dental treatment. Since graduating she has worked
in a number of clinical environments across South Wales and Bristol, including primary care and
hospital based roles treating and supporting patients with head and neck cancer. This has laid the
foundations for Emma’s knowledge and experience in looking after the gum health of patients
with complex medical histories in a gentle and thorough way.
Emma enjoys working together with her patients, taking the time to understand their busy
lifestyles to design a personalised prevention plan to optimise dental and periodontal health in
order to maintain healthy teeth.

She has a particular interest in Restorative Dentistry where she strives to achieve the best
possible aesthetic outcomes. She aims to ensure patients have the best possible experience at
each appointment and making every effort to allow them to feel comfortable and relaxed during
their time with her.
